On May 12, Italian Nights are proud to bring to London a double whammy of an event: a jazz evening combined with a photographic competition and exhibition.

Jazz and photography together under one roof, as part of the same event - why not? Those sitting in front of the music stage will be able to see back-projections of the selected photos - while those ambling about in the exhibition on the floor below will get to hear the live music through loudspeakers. Total freedom to roam from one level to the other. Here is a format bound to create a gripping synergy between the image and the sound. Natural allies, the riffer and the snapper...

As in our first-ever Italian Jazz Festival back in 2008, Italian Nights will bring to London top-of-the-range jazz musicians - and we are calling on all photography lovers out there to send us their submissions to add to the mix. The chosen entries will be diplayed on the day at the Italian Cultural Institute in Belgrave Square, and the very best will receive prizes.
